Conveniences of Advanced Cataract Surgery



When taking into consideration innovative cataract surgical treatment, you can expect improved vision and faster healing times compared to standard techniques. Advanced cataract surgical treatment methods, such as laser-assisted procedures, supply greater precision in eliminating the over cast lens and changing it with a clear artificial lens. This accuracy brings about far better aesthetic end results, with numerous patients experiencing dramatically sharper vision post-surgery. Additionally, advanced cataract surgical treatment often results in faster recovery times, enabling you to resume your daily tasks quicker.

An additional benefit of innovative cataract surgical treatment is decreased reliance on glasses or call lenses after the treatment. With innovations in intraocular lens modern technology, cosmetic surgeons can now use lens implants that fix not just cataracts yet also various other refractive errors like n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ism. This suggests that you may achieve clearer vision at various distances without the demand for corrective eyewear.

Threats and Difficulties to Consider



Taking into consideration advanced cataract surgery likewise entails recognizing the possible dangers and complications that may develop during or after the procedure.

In many cases, there may be problems with the intraocular lens, such as dislocation or clouding of the lens. Furthermore, there's a small risk of retinal detachment or glaucoma developing after the surgery.

Problems can also arise throughout the healing procedure. Some individuals may experience increased eye stress, bring about pain or adjustments in vision. It's crucial to comply with post-operative care directions faithfully to reduce these dangers. If you see any sudden changes in your vision, severe discomfort, or various other concerning signs, call your eye surgeon right away.

While these risks exist, it's vital to evaluate them against the potential advantages of boosted vision and lifestyle that progressed cataract surgical treatment can provide.

Patient Viability and Eligibility



To establish if you're suitable for innovative cataract surgery, your eye surgeon will examine various elements including the health of your eyes and general medical history. Variables such as the seriousness of your cataracts, the visibility of various other eye problems like glaucoma or macular deterioration, and the general health of your eyes will all be considered. Additionally, your doctor will assess your basic health condition, including any type of clinical problems you might have and medicines you're taking.

It is necessary to connect openly with your eye surgeon regarding any kind of existing health issues, previous eye surgical procedures, or drugs you're presently utilizing. Your specialist will certainly likewise consider your expectations and way of living when establishing if progressed cataract surgical treatment is the right choice for you.
